Lines Matching refs:cpu
271 * don't change SIP_UARTDBG_FN to SIP_UARTDBG_CFG64 even when cpu is AArch32
287 unsigned long cpu);
305 /* copy cpu context: x0 ~ spsr_el3 */
375 unsigned long cpu)
384 sip_fiq_debugger_uart_irq_tf(fiq_pt_regs, cpu);
424 static ulong cpu_logical_map_mpidr(u32 cpu)
430 if (cpu < 4)
432 mpidr = cpu;
433 else if (cpu < 8)
435 mpidr = 0x100 | (cpu - 4);
437 pr_err("Unsupported map cpu: %d\n", cpu);
441 return cpu_logical_map(cpu);
445 int sip_fiq_debugger_switch_cpu(u32 cpu)
449 fiq_target_cpu = cpu;
450 res = __invoke_sip_fn_smc(SIP_UARTDBG_FN, cpu_logical_map_mpidr(cpu),
557 * We get info from cpuid and compare with all supported ARMv7 cpu.